客服联系方式

当前位置:首页 » 论文摘要 » 正文

论文摘要:英特网环境下面向服务的动态协同技术研究

8929 人参与  2022年02月02日 14:05  分类 : 论文摘要  评论

随着面向服务思想的不断深入、Web服务技术的不断成熟,面向服务的软件技术逐渐被工业界接受,并成为Internet环境下应用系统开发的重要技术之一。面向服务计算和面向服务体系结构已被广泛接受,成为构造下一代Internet应用的计算范型和体系结构。Internet的不断普及使计算机软件开发、部署、运行和维护的环境开始从封闭、静态逐步走向开放、动态。由于Internet环境的开放性、动态性、演化性及分布性,面向服务的动态软件协同技术成为软件技术研究的重要问题和关键挑战之一。首先,面向服务的应用系统在基础资源、系统功能、运行环境等方面存在动态、不确定因素,这为面向服务软件开发方法及面向服务软件支撑技术带来了新的挑战,研究服务动态协同的体系框架,可解决动态环境下面向服务应用系统的体系结构、运行框架和软件开发方法所面临的问题;第二,从软件体系结构的角度看,面向服务应用系统的体系结构在系统运行过程中将是不断变化的,需要研究系统结构的演化机制,以有效提高面向服务应用系统的适应性和可靠性;第三,从软件系统行为的角度看,软件环境及系统结构的变化需要系统的行为相应调整,反之,系统行为也可动态改变体系结构,因此需要一种服务动态协同行为的刻画方法来支持系统行为的建模;第四,从系统运行方式的角度看,Internet上组成应用系统的服务将是对等、非中心控制的,实现非中心方式下体系结构的动态调整及协同行为的动态改变就需要有一种分布式的服务协调机制。针对上述问题,本文提出了一种新的服务动态协同体系框架,重点研究了面向服务协同结构的演化机制、服务动态协同行为以及服务之间的分布式动态协调方法。主要研究成果如下:(1) 提出了一种服务动态协同体系框架—DySC,给出了DySC的体系结构与软件框架,DySC扩展了传统的面向服务软件体系结构,针对系统结构和系统行为的动态性,增加了动态协调的体系结构层次;提出了一种基于DySC的软件开发过程,并给出了协同结构及演化、协同行为及分解、分布式动态协调三种方法支撑服务动态协同系统的建模与运行;提出了基于DySC的软件建模方法,从全局的角度以协同结构图和协同行为图分别对系统结构和行为进行建模。(2) 提出了基于图文法的面向服务协同结构约束演化模型,给出协同结构的形式化表示方法,包括开放协同结构、协同结构模式、产生式规则和演化规约;证明了协同结构替换的可结合性,给出了协同结构推导的方法并证明了协同结构推导的顺序无关性;以协同结构态射为基础研究了协同结构的运行时约束演化过程模型,给出了协同结构的类型约束和拓扑约束两种约束机制。(3) 提出了一种服务动态协同行为模型—SYCOM,在服务交互行为的基础上着重分析协同结构的演化行为,给出了协同行为的语义;给出了协同行为的结构同余性质,并以语义函数为基础,提出了协同行为的语义相等性及定理,分析了协同行为的语义确定性。进一步分析了SYCOM的连通性、类型检查方法,并结合SPIN模型验证工具给出了协同行为分解方法,验证了服务动态协同行为的状态可达性和无死锁等性质。(4) 提出了一种非中心模式的Web服务动态协调方法,基于情境演算的方法建立了服务协调的情境模型,给出了演化动作的前置条件和执行效果公理,并将协同结构约束转化为逻辑谓词表示,形成自适应演化目标情境的逻辑条件;设计了一种Web服务协调机制,以会话依赖关系为基础分析系统演化的状态满足性,并给出了服务协调的具体过程和算法;设计了服务动态协同引擎的体系结构,通过扩展基本的BPEL引擎的方式在内部增加协调层实现分布式服务之间的自主协调,并通过实验证明方法的有效性。

来源:半壳优胜育转载请保留出处和链接!

本文链接:http://87cpy.com/209886.html

云彩店APP下载
云彩店APP下载

本站部分内容来源网络如有侵权请联系删除

<< 上一篇 下一篇 >>

  • 评论(0)
  • 赞助本站

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。

站内导航

足球简报

篮球简报

云彩店邀请码54967

    云彩店app|云彩店邀请码|云彩店下载|半壳|优胜

NBA | CBA | 中超 | 亚冠 | 英超 | 德甲 | 西甲 | 法甲 | 意甲 | 欧冠 | 欧洲杯 | 冬奥会 | 残奥会 | 世界杯 | 比赛直播 |

Copyright 半壳优胜体育 Rights Reserved.